Asparagus has been creating zines to express her and the world’s emotions since around 2017. Now also comics! Recurring themes in her work include the destigmatization of vulnerability, self-awareness, the naturalistic element, body positivity, and the empowerment of communities and individuals, through a queer feminist lens. She chooses to make experiential works, while her comics touch on slice of life. She loves watercolors, inks, and pencils, and enjoys hiding something from the plant kingdom in her works—a habit she picked up from studying Agronomy at Aristotle University of Thessaloniki. Asparagus plumosa is, after all, an ornamental asparagus!
